While a lot of the North East coasts’ rap fanbase was up in Philadelphia for the Made In America festival, the other chunk of hip-hop heads were in New Jersey for Rock The Bells. Artists such as the Wu-Tang Clan, Curren$y, Murs & Fashawn, and plenty of others touched the stage, it was Nas’ set that stole the show.

Nas, who is still riding the unbelievable wave of Life Is Goodhit the stage and performed numerous cuts off of that album along with his classic records. The crowd hit a fever pitch when he brought out Scarface to perform “Hip-Hop” off of DJ Khaled’s Kiss The Ring. Lauryn Hill also came out with Nas to perform “Ready Or Not” and “If I Ruled The World.” Hit the jump to check out all the footage.
